Handling missing data in a composite outcome with partially observed components: Application in clustered paediatric routine data.
2019-10-03
Abstract excerpt
<title>Abstract</title> <p>Background: In health care settings, composite measures are used to combine information from multiple quality of care measures into a single summary score. Composite scores provide global insights and trends about complex and multidimensional quality of care processes.
